Feed conveyor belt and coupler

A belt and coupler arrangement for a feederhouse feed conveyor of an agricultural harvester includes an elongate belt having an elongate web (154) with a first end (102) and a second end (104), wherein the first end (102) and the second end (104) are thicker than the elongate web; and a coupler (100) having a first elongate recess to receive and enclose the first end (102), and a second elongate recess to receive and enclose the second end (104).

DRIVE-BELT CONNECTING DEVICE DESIGNED FOR THE TENSION-RESISTANT CONNECTION OF FLAT DRIVE-BELT END SECTIONS, DRIVE BELT, AND CONVEYING DEVICE EQUIPPED THEREWITH

The invention relates to a drive belt connecting device for the tension-resistant connection of fiat drive belt end sections (93, 94), which drive belt connecting device comprises a multi-part connecting body (41), which has connecting parts (1, 2, 3) and a connecting chamber (42), which accommodates the drive belt end sections (93, 94), which have at least one first belt flat side having a belt surface profile (911) in an overlapping arrangement for tension-resistant connection. A first outer connecting part (1) and a second outer connecting part (2) bound the connecting chamber (42), in which an inner connecting part (3) having inner connecting surfaces (301, 302) is arranged. The inner connecting surfaces and outer connecting surfaces (101, 201) of the outer connecting parts (1, 2) can be placed onto the drive belt end sections (93, 94). A fastening means (5) fastens the outer connecting parts (1, 2) to each other at a limited fixed distance. An inner connecting means (30) connects the inner connecting part (3) to at least one of the two outer connecting parts (1, 2) for connection that is secure in the belt tension direction. A flat drive belt (90) is connected to a circulating continuous flat drive belt (90) by means of at least one said drive belt connecting device (4). A conveying device (7) comprises two such drive belts (901, 902), which can be guided and driven along a conveying path (78) and a return path (79) to circulate together and in parallel, wherein one conveyor belt (75) is formed by a series of transport elements (73) arranged in parallel and transport blocks (74) fastened onto the two drive belts (901, 902) to support said transport elements. Connecting bodies (41) of the drive belt connecting devices (4) are configured as transport blocks (74).

CONNECTOR FOR MECHANICALLY LINKING CONVEYOR BELTS

The invention relates to conveyor technology, and specifically to belt conveyors, and can be used in underground mining operations, including in coal mines. A connector for mechanically linking conveyor belts contains an assembly comprising two profiled plates and a connecting element; each profiled plate is provided, in the center thereof, with a through-hole in which the connecting element, in the form of a bolt, is located, the bolt head corresponding to a receiving seat in the upper profiled plate; the inner surfaces of the profiled plates are each provided with symmetrically arranged profiled protrusions, and a nut is pressed into the centrally-located through-hole of the lower profiled plate; the upper profiled plate is equipped with additional tapered holes (recessions) symmetrically arranged between the profiled protrusions, at that these tapered holes (recessions) being provided on the inner surface of the profiled plate.

Conveyor belt and agricultural harvester with a conveyor belt

A conveyor belt has one or more conveyor belt segments made of an elastomeric material layer and a reinforcement layer of steel ropes disposed in the elastomeric material layer and oriented in a longitudinal direction of the conveyor belt segment. The conveyor belt segments each have a first segment end provided with a first transverse lock bar and a second segment end provided with a second transverse lock bar, wherein ends of the steel ropes are locked frictionally or with form fit in the first and second transverse lock bars, respectively. One or more detachable closure members couple the first and second transverse lock bars of a single one or of adjacently positioned ones of the conveyor belt segments to each other in a rigid correlation relative to each other.

SUPPORTING WASHER

The present disclosure provides a washer having a generally circular shape and is used for supporting a screw head. The shank of the screw penetrates the central hole of the washer. When viewed from a planar perspective, the outer edges of the washer have a sinusoidal shape with depressions and elevations.
